As mentioned above, Ceramic and Jet Hot are one in the same. But, the Ceramic is really primarily ALUMINUM. It's soft compared to chrome, but taken care of will probably hold up better than chrome. Seems to me the chrome ones always rust, and often turn blue.
Over VERY important item on the Ceramic coating... there is MUCH less heat transfer into the engine compartment, and the pipes cool MUCH faster.

If your chrome is turning blue it is because your car is running too rich - lean it out some. You can easily clean bule and gold away with Blue Job Chrome Polish. I used it on my '69 that had chrome hookers that were both blue and gold when I got them, the stuff is amazing.
